Frequently Asked Questions

What is the population and demographic makeup of ZIP code 39174?

The total population of ZIP code 39174 is approximately 2,324. The community has a large population of young adults (18-34). This demographic data is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au.

Do more people rent or own homes in ZIP code 39174?

The housing market in ZIP code 39174 is predominantly driven by renters, with 22% of housing units being owner-occupied and 78% being renter-occupied.
